Latest Trends in Bathroom Remodeling: Why Professional Bathroom Remodeling Services Matter
In 2024, bathroom remodeling will be more popular than ever. The North American bath remodeling market was valued at $67.7 billion in 2023 and is expected to grow at a rate of 2.9% from 2024 to 2032 (source).
This growth shows that many homeowners are updating their bathrooms to match modern styles and technologies. Staying informed about the latest trends in bathroom remodeling helps you create a space that is both functional and beautiful.

6 Latest Trends in Bathroom Remodeling and the Role of Professional Remodeling Services
Smart and High-Tech Bathroom Features
Smart Showers and Faucets: Modern bathrooms now include touchless and voice-activated showers and faucets. These features make it easy to control water flow and temperature, adding convenience to your daily routine.
Intelligent Toilets: Today's toilets offer heated seats, self-cleaning functions, and built-in bidets. They also use less water, making them eco-friendly and cost-effective.
Smart Mirrors and Lighting: LED mirrors with anti-fog technology and motion-sensor lights are becoming common. These additions improve visibility and add a modern touch to your bathroom.
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Designs
Water-Efficient Fixtures: Homeowners are choosing low-flow showerheads and dual-flush toilets to save water. These fixtures reduce water usage without compromising performance.
Energy-Efficient Lighting and Heating: Using LED lights lowers energy consumption. Radiant heated floors provide warmth efficiently, enhancing comfort during colder months.
Recycled and Sustainable Materials: Materials like bamboo flooring and recycled glass countertops are popular choices. They are durable and have a smaller environmental footprint.
Spa-Inspired Luxury Bathrooms
Freestanding Bathtubs and Rainfall Showers: Deep-soaking tubs and showers with steam features create a spa-like experience at home. These elements offer relaxation and a touch of luxury.
Heated Flooring and Towel Racks: Adding heated floors and towel racks brings extra comfort, especially in cooler climates. These features ensure warmth as you step out of the shower or bath.
Ambient Lighting and Sound Systems: Incorporating mood lighting and built-in speakers enhances relaxation. These features allow you to set the perfect atmosphere for unwinding.
Minimalist and Space-Saving Designs

Floating Vanities and Wall-Mounted Storage: Wall-mounted vanities and storage units free up floor space, making bathrooms feel more open and organized.
Frameless Glass Shower Enclosures: Clear glass shower enclosures create a spacious look and are easy to clean, adding to the minimalist appeal.
Neutral Color Palettes and Simple Designs: Using neutral colors and straightforward designs creates a calm and timeless bathroom environment.
Universal Design and Accessibility Features
Barrier-Free Showers and Walk-In Tubs: Showers without barriers and easy-access tubs make bathrooms safer and more convenient for everyone, including those with mobility challenges.
Grab Bars and Non-Slip Flooring: Installing grab bars and non-slip floors helps prevent accidents, enhancing safety without sacrificing style.
Customization and Personalization
Bold Tile Patterns and Unique Textures: Homeowners are experimenting with geometric tiles and varied textures to add character and personal flair to their bathrooms through professional bathroom remodeling services.
Statement Fixtures and Finishes: Choosing distinctive fixtures in finishes like brushed gold or mixed metals can serve as focal points, elevating the bathroom's design.
Personalized Storage Solutions: Custom shelves and hidden storage keep bathrooms organized, ensuring that the space meets individual needs and preferences.
